An Accelerated Kernel-Independent Fast Multipole Method in One Dimension
A version of the fast multipole method (FMM) is described for charge distributions on the line. The kernel-independent fast multipole method (KIFMM) proposed in [1] is of almost linear complexity. In the original KIFMM the time-consuming M2L translations are accelerated by FFT. However, when more equivalent points are used to achieve higher accuracy, the efficiency of the FFT approach tends to be lower because more auxiliary volume grid points have to be added. متن کاملA Fourier-series-based kernel-independent fast multipole method
We present in this paper a new kernel-independent fast multipole method (FMM), named as FKI-FMM, for pairwise particle interactions with translation-invariant kernel functions. FKI-FMM creates, using numerical techniques, sufficiently accurate and compressive representations of a given kernel function over multi-scale interaction regions in the form of a truncated Fourier series. متن کاملA kernel-independent fast multipole algorithm
We present a new fast multipole method for particle simulations. The main feature of our algorithm is that is kernel independent, in the sense that no analytic expansions are used to represent the far field.
